Job Opening Conservation Administrator

The Town of Ayer is seeking applications from qualified candidates for the position of Conservation Administrator. The Conservation Administrator works independently to manage the Conservation Commission's Office and the timely administration of the Commission's statutory and regulatory responsibilities under the Massachusetts Wetlands Protection Act and local wetland bylaw.

Responsibilities include interacting with project applicants and the public; review and processing project applications; writing Orders of Conditions and other permits; performing field inspections for project planning; wetland delineations; erosion control review. Manages all aspects of the Commission's office including filing, budget, accounts payables, mail, and office supplies. Works collaboratively with other Town boards and departments on wetlands and stormwater related issues. Other duties as assigned.

Minimum qualifications:

• Bachelor's degree in environmental science, wetlands biology or related degree;

• Minimum of two to three years of experience in associated field or any reasonable equivalent of education and experience. MACC Fundamentals for Conservation certification required or in process.

• Excellent interpersonal skills, both written and verbal.

• Computer skills, including fluency in MS Word, Excel, Outlook, and Internet Explorer.

• Familiarity with GIS Mapping a plus.

• Knowledge of land use and surveying techniques, wetlands biology, hydrology and soils a must.

• Regular field inspections are an essential function.

• Candidates must be physically able to walk moderate distance outdoors.

 

Salary: $25.16/hour ($52,534 annual). Full time/benefitted union position including mileage reimbursement for fieldwork.
